Home
last modified time | relevance | path

Searched defs:shader (Results 676 - 700 of 1249) sorted by relevance

1...<<21222324252627282930>>...50

/third_party/mesa3d/src/compiler/nir/
H A Dnir_lower_gs_intrinsics.c278 nir_shader *shader = state->builder->shader; in append_set_vertex_and_primitive_count() local
367 nir_lower_gs_intrinsics(nir_shader *shader, nir_lower_gs_intrinsics_flag argument
[all...]
H A Dnir_lower_idiv.c278 nir_lower_idiv(nir_shader *shader, const nir_lower_idiv_options *options) in nir_lower_idiv() argument
H A Dnir_opt_dead_cf.c426 nir_opt_dead_cf(nir_shader *shader) in nir_opt_dead_cf() argument
H A Dnir_opt_dce.c242 nir_opt_dce(nir_shader *shader) in nir_opt_dce() argument
H A Dnir_opt_preamble.c37 nir_shader_get_preamble(nir_shader *shader) in nir_shader_get_preamble() argument
338 nir_opt_preamble(nir_shader *shader, const nir_opt_preamble_options *options, in nir_opt_preamble() argument
H A Dnir_lower_alu_width.c132 will_lower_ffma(nir_shader *shader, unsigned bit_size) in will_lower_ffma() argument
412 nir_lower_alu_width(nir_shader *shader, nir_vectorize_cb cb, const void *_data) nir_lower_alu_width() argument
439 nir_lower_alu_to_scalar(nir_shader *shader, nir_instr_filter_cb cb, const void *_data) nir_lower_alu_to_scalar() argument
[all...]
H A Dnir_lower_alu.c228 nir_lower_alu(nir_shader *shader) in nir_lower_alu() argument
H A Dnir_divergence_analysis.c41 nir_shader *shader; member
81 visit_intrinsic(nir_shader *shader, nir_intrinsic_instr *instr) in visit_intrinsic() argument
698 nir_variable_is_uniform(nir_shader *shader, nir_variable *var) in nir_variable_is_uniform() argument
726 visit_deref(nir_shader *shader, nir_deref_inst argument
792 update_instr_divergence(nir_shader *shader, nir_instr *instr) update_instr_divergence() argument
1070 nir_divergence_analysis(nir_shader *shader) nir_divergence_analysis() argument
1086 nir_update_instr_divergence(nir_shader *shader, nir_instr *instr) nir_update_instr_divergence() argument
1108 nir_has_divergent_loop(nir_shader *shader) nir_has_divergent_loop() argument
[all...]
H A Dnir_gather_info.c53 get_deref_info(nir_shader *shader, nir_variable *var, nir_deref_instr *deref, in get_deref_info() argument
94 set_io_mask(nir_shader *shader, nir_variable *var, int offset, int len, in set_io_mask() argument
194 mark_whole_variable(nir_shader *shader, nir_variable *var, nir_deref_instr *deref, bool is_output_read) mark_whole_variable() argument
270 try_mask_partial_io(nir_shader *shader, nir_variable *var, nir_deref_instr *deref, bool is_output_read) try_mask_partial_io() argument
467 gather_intrinsic_info(nir_intrinsic_instr *instr, nir_shader *shader, void *dead_ctx) gather_intrinsic_info() argument
844 gather_tex_info(nir_tex_instr *instr, nir_shader *shader) gather_tex_info() argument
860 gather_alu_info(nir_alu_instr *instr, nir_shader *shader) gather_alu_info() argument
893 gather_func_info(nir_function_impl *func, nir_shader *shader, struct set *visited_funcs, void *dead_ctx) gather_func_info() argument
905 gather_alu_info(nir_instr_as_alu(instr), shader); gather_func_info() local
908 gather_intrinsic_info(nir_instr_as_intrinsic(instr), shader, dead_ctx); gather_func_info() local
911 gather_tex_info(nir_instr_as_tex(instr), shader); gather_func_info() local
929 nir_shader_gather_info(nir_shader *shader, nir_function_impl *entrypoint) nir_shader_gather_info() argument
[all...]
H A Dnir_group_loads.c469 nir_group_loads(nir_shader *shader, nir_load_grouping grouping, in nir_group_loads() argument
H A Dnir_lower_clip.c44 create_clipdist_var(nir_shader *shader, in create_clipdist_var() argument
74 create_clipdist_vars(nir_shader *shader, nir_variable **io_vars, in create_clipdist_vars() argument
169 find_output(nir_shader *shader, unsigned drvloc) find_output() argument
195 find_clipvertex_and_position_outputs(nir_shader *shader, nir_variable **clipvertex, nir_variable **position) find_clipvertex_and_position_outputs() argument
325 nir_lower_clip_vs(nir_shader *shader, unsigned ucp_enables, bool use_vars, bool use_clipdist_array, const gl_state_index16 clipplane_state_tokens[][STATE_LENGTH]) nir_lower_clip_vs() argument
398 nir_lower_clip_gs(nir_shader *shader, unsigned ucp_enables, bool use_clipdist_array, const gl_state_index16 clipplane_state_tokens[][STATE_LENGTH]) nir_lower_clip_gs() argument
472 fs_has_clip_dist_input_var(nir_shader *shader, nir_variable **io_vars, unsigned *ucp_enables) fs_has_clip_dist_input_var() argument
493 nir_lower_clip_fs(nir_shader *shader, unsigned ucp_enables, bool use_clipdist_array) nir_lower_clip_fs() argument
[all...]
H A Dnir_lower_const_arrays_to_uniforms.c132 lower_const_array_to_uniform(nir_shader *shader, struct var_info *info, in lower_const_array_to_uniform() argument
220 count_uniforms(nir_shader *shader) in count_uniforms() argument
232 nir_lower_const_arrays_to_uniforms(nir_shader *shader, in nir_lower_const_arrays_to_uniforms() argument
[all...]
H A Dnir_inline_uniforms.c317 nir_find_inlinable_uniforms(nir_shader *shader) in nir_find_inlinable_uniforms() argument
338 nir_inline_uniforms(nir_shader *shader, unsigned num_uniforms, in nir_inline_uniforms() argument
H A Dnir_lower_blend.c494 nir_lower_blend(nir_shader *shader, const nir_lower_blend_options *options) in nir_lower_blend() argument
[all...]
H A Dnir_lower_bit_size.c280 nir_lower_bit_size(nir_shader *shader, in nir_lower_bit_size() argument
365 nir_lower_64bit_phis(nir_shader *shader) in nir_lower_64bit_phis() argument
H A Dnir_lower_flrp.c632 nir_lower_flrp(nir_shader *shader, in nir_lower_flrp() argument
/third_party/mesa3d/src/freedreno/ir3/
H A Dir3_context.c34 ir3_context_init(struct ir3_compiler *compiler, struct ir3_shader *shader, in ir3_context_init() argument
H A Dir3_cp.c47 struct ir3 *shader; member
/third_party/mesa3d/src/freedreno/isa/
H A Dencode.c330 struct ir3 *shader = v->ir; in isa_assemble() local
/third_party/mesa3d/src/compiler/glsl/
H A Dgl_nir_link_uniform_blocks.c414 allocate_uniform_blocks(void *mem_ctx, struct gl_linked_shader *shader, struct gl_uniform_block **out_blks, unsigned *num_blocks, struct gl_uniform_buffer_variable **out_variables, unsigned *num_variables, enum block_type block_type) allocate_uniform_blocks() argument
544 link_linked_shader_uniform_blocks(void *mem_ctx, struct gl_shader_program *prog, struct gl_linked_shader *shader, struct gl_uniform_block **blocks, unsigned *num_blocks, enum block_type block_type) link_linked_shader_uniform_blocks() argument
[all...]
H A Dlower_distance.cpp659 lower_clip_cull_distance(struct gl_shader_program *prog, struct gl_linked_shader *shader) lower_clip_cull_distance() argument
[all...]
H A Dgl_nir_opt_dead_builtin_varyings.c132 get_varying_info(struct varying_info *info, nir_shader *shader, in get_varying_info() argument
235 struct gl_linked_shader *shader; member
245 create_new_var(nir_shader *shader, char *name, nir_variable_mode mode, const struct glsl_type *type) create_new_var() argument
307 prepare_array(struct replace_varyings_data *rv_data, nir_shader *shader, nir_variable **new_var, int max_elements, unsigned start_location, const char *var_name, const char *mode_str, unsigned usage, unsigned external_usage) prepare_array() argument
342 replace_varyings(const struct gl_constants *consts, struct gl_linked_shader *shader, struct gl_shader_program *prog, const struct varying_info *info, unsigned external_texcoord_usage, unsigned external_color_usage, bool external_has_fog) replace_varyings() argument
450 lower_texcoord_array(const struct gl_constants *consts, struct gl_linked_shader *shader, struct gl_shader_program *prog, const struct varying_info *info) lower_texcoord_array() argument
[all...]
/third_party/mesa3d/src/amd/compiler/
H A Daco_instruction_selection.h60 nir_shader* shader; member
/third_party/mesa3d/src/amd/vulkan/
H A Dradv_nir_lower_ycbcr_textures.c302 radv_nir_lower_ycbcr_textures(nir_shader *shader, const struct radv_pipeline_layout *layout) in radv_nir_lower_ycbcr_textures() argument
/third_party/mesa3d/src/gallium/drivers/v3d/
H A Dv3d_screen.c349 v3d_screen_get_shader_param(struct pipe_screen *pscreen, unsigned shader, in v3d_screen_get_shader_param() argument
747 v3d_screen_get_compiler_options(struct pipe_screen *pscreen, enum pipe_shader_ir ir, unsigned shader) v3d_screen_get_compiler_options() argument

Completed in 20 milliseconds

1...<<21222324252627282930>>...50